What the numbers say
About 7,300 Project Management Specialists work in the Nashville metro, making it a sizable market for the role in Tennessee. The 2024 median annual wage was $86,930, roughly 2.5% above the Tennessee median of $84,800. Against the national figure of $100,946, though, Nashville sits about 14% lower.
The spread between top and bottom earners is wide. The 10th percentile came in at $56,150 while the 90th hit $145,010. That is a gap of nearly $89,000 across the same job title in the same city. Experience, industry, and how senior someone is account for most of that distance. A project manager running IT implementations at a healthcare company will generally land in a different part of that range than one coordinating interior build-outs for a mid-size contractor.
The mean wage of $96,090 runs about $9,000 above the median, which tells us a smaller group of higher-paid specialists pulls the average up. That pattern is common in metros where a handful of large employers, healthcare systems or corporate headquarters, tend to pay senior managers well above the midpoint.
Nashville pays above the Tennessee statewide figure, but the gap is modest. The bigger story here is how far the local median sits below the national one. That $14,000 difference reflects what the market in this region pays for the role, not a ceiling on individual earning potential, since the 90th-percentile figure in Nashville clears six figures by a wide margin.
